Description:

  • Scientific Name: Centella Asiatica
  • Common Names: Vallarai (Tamil), Gotu Kola, Indian Pennywort, Mandukaparni, Brahmi (though it is often confused with Bacopa monnieri, another plant with similar uses).
  • Family: Apiaceae (Carrot family).

Characteristics of the Vallarai Plant:

  • Appearance: Vallarai is a small, creeping herb that thrives in tropical and subtropical climates. It has round or heart-shaped leaves with serrated edges. The plant often grows in wet, marshy areas and can also be cultivated in gardens or pots.
  • Height: It typically grows to about 6-12 inches (15-30 cm) in height.
  • Flowers: The plant produces small, pale purple or white flowers.
  • Parts Used: The leaves, stems, and roots of the plant are used in medicinal preparations, though the leaves are most commonly utilized.
